Tips For Homeowners on Septic System Health in Satellite Beach, FL.

As everyone knows, no residence is complete without a waste tank. For those of us who own houses, it is imperative to pay meticulous attention to keeping up of your sewage system's condition, since it directly affects not only your own well-being but also the environment.

Imagine the inconvenience of rising early and realizing that your toilet is backed up, or putting up with the noxious stench wafting from a sewage tank spill.

Below are some simple procedures for householders to adhere to to maintain properly care for the wellness of their sewage system.

Regular Inspection and Pumping

Typically, a residential septic tank should be professionally inspected on a regular basis, typically every 3-5 years by skilled professionals. Throughout this inspection, the professional examiners can check for leaks, inspect the top and base of your waste tank, analyze the accumulated scum and sludge in your sewage tank, and execute skilled pumping of your waste tank.

Efficient Use Of Water

Minimizing water usage in a home equates to reduced water entering the sewage system. Restroom usage accounts for about 25-30% of water consumption in the residential property. An optimal method to decrease water usage in the toilet involves replacing current models with high-efficiency ones, employing less gallons of water for each flushing.

High Efficiency Shower Heads

Water used during showering is also sent to the sewage system. To minimize this, the smart choice involves using high-efficiency shower heads, crafted to lower water consumption.

Proper Disposal of Waste

Numerous folks exhibit the bad habit of dealing with the bathroom as if it were a trash can. However, practicing this conduct inevitably sewage system obstructions. So, householders should make sure that everyone in the household disposes of waste appropriately and doesn't flush it in the toilet.

Types Of Septic Tank Systems Available

When septic tank installation, experts consider various elements into account, including but not limited to the size of the property, weather patterns, climatic conditions of the area, soil type, and more.

All of these aspects play a role in determining the appropriate type of septic tank system for installation. Below are numerous varieties of sewage tank systems available for installation at DJ Plumbing Septic Tank Services:

Conventional Tank System

Commonly described as a gravity-fed septic system, this specific type of septic system is both the most prevalent and the most straightforward to install and maintain. This particular septic tank system doesn't need any extra electrical or technological work. Instead, it banks solely on natural forces, specifically gravity.

Chamber Septic Tank System

The chamber septic tank system, utilizes drain chambers usually crafted from plastic, specifically high-density polyethylene. However,, it's important to point out that other materials can be utilized for these chambers.

During the previous three decades, this particular type of septic tank system has gained significant popularity, largely because of its economical installation and straightforward setup. Its maintenance follows a similar process to the conventional a regular sewage tank system.

Mound Septic Tank System

This particular septic tank system is utilized for properties situated on thin soil or in close proximity to surface rock formations. This type of septic system involves creating a constructed mound consisting of distinct levels of soil, gravel, and sand as the drainfield.

In contrast to standard septic tank system, this particular septic tank system uses electrical energy, as well as demands periodic maintenance and examinations, unlike the typical septic tank system, which is substantially easier to manage.

Aerobic Treatment Unit

Referred to as Aerobic Treatment Units (ATUs), this specific septic tank system makes use of an electric pump to facilitate oxygen into the septic tank. The addition of oxygen allows oxygen-loving microorganisms to flourish within the septic tank. This process causes the biodegradation of waste materials in the septic tank.

Usually, such septic tank is constructed in regions near surface water or where there are unfavorable soil characteristics. It's important to note that maintaining such septic tank system comes with a high cost, because it demands ongoing maintenance treatments.

Recirculating Sand Filter Septic Tank System

This particular septic tank system makes use of sand filtration to process and redistribute of wastewater. To work efficiently, this system requires the use of electricity. When compared to other types of sewage tanks, the setup and ongoing care of this system can be on the pricier side.

Satellite Beach is a coastal city in Brevard County, Florida, U.S. The population was 11,346 at the 2020 United States Census, and it is located with the Atlantic Ocean to the east and the Banana River to the west.
